This guide explores the techniques and processes used to develop some visual applications. Placing the subject in context with the real world, the authors provide a study in four stages: basic programming concepts, visual metaphors and the problems of perception, applications and case studies. Includes coverage of Java, VRML, intelligent software, bit radiation and layered image processing.
